Correct specification of addresses in the invoice* | The Ministry of Finance clarifies that the addresses of the taxpayer and the purchaser in an invoice may be stated with abbreviations, uppercase and lowercase letters, and a change of word order in the street name unless this prevents the tax authorities from identifying the sellers and the buyers of goods. (Letter of the Ministry of Finance of January 17, 2018 N 03-07-09 / 1846).
*It refers to the form of invoice required by law in Russia, which must be duly completed for VAT purposes within a prescribed period.
| | | | | 2. Exemption from VAT of services of foreign companies for providing access to information materials
| Providing online access to information materials such as databases and computer applications is subject to VAT (paragraph 2 of paragraph 1 of Article 174.2 of the Tax Code of the Russian Federation). If the above services are provided under a license agreement, they are exempted from VAT (Letter No. 03-07-08 / 87817 of the Ministry of Finance of the Russian Federation of December 28, 2017).

Changes in currency control | As of March 1, 2018, modified currency control rules will apply regarding the notification requirements: the registration of transaction passports (Russian - "Passport Sdelki") will not be necessary and only foreign trade contracts will have to be registered. The Central Bank of Russia has prepared corresponding forms to be submitted electronically ("Rules for the preparation and submission of information in electronic form by the instructions of the Central Bank of Russia, 16th of August 2017, N 181-И).
